William Walter Irwin Jr 1923 - 2003

William Walter Irwin Jr was born on December 2, 1923, and died at age 80 years old on December 31, 2003. William Irwin was buried at Baton Rouge National Cemetery Section 10 Site 5A 220 North 19th Street, in Baton Rouge, La. In 1923, in the year that William Walter Irwin Jr was born, on November 8th and 9th, Adolf Hitler and his followers (the early Nazi party) staged the "Beer Hall Putsch" in Munich in an attempt to take over Bavaria (a state in Germany). They failed. Hitler was charged with treason and convicted, receiving a sentence of 5 years. He served under 1 year in jail.

In 1931, William was merely 8 years old when on May 1st, the Empire State Building opened in New York City. At 1,454 feet (including the roof and antenna), it was the tallest building in the world until the World Trade Center's North Tower was built in 1970. (It is now the 34th tallest.) Opening at the beginning of the Great Depression, most of the offices in the Empire State Building remained unoccupied for years and the observation deck was an equal source of revenue and kept the building profitable.
